Jigawa police arrest three kidnappers, recover cows, motorcycles

The Jigawa State Police Command has arrested three suspected kidnappers, according to the state Police Public Relations Officer, Shiisu Adam.

Adam disclosed this information in a statement provided to journalists on Friday, emphasizing the commendable efforts of the police in addressing security challenges.

He explained that the police responded to a distress call on November 17, 2023, reporting the kidnapping of a 63-year-old businessman, Alhaji Shehu Kwaimawa, in Kwaimawa village, Dutse.

The PPRO highlighted that, acting on a tip-off, a joint operation team, comprising police officers, State Intelligence Bureau operatives, and members of the Vigilante Group of Nigeria, conducted a raid on Rigija Fulani settlement in Hara Village, Dutse LGA on November 18, 2023.

Adam detailed the outcomes of the operation, stating, “The operation resulted in the recovery of 29 cows, four sheep, a broken butt of a rifle, one chain, and a Boxer Motorcycle with registration number KMC 790 HJ Kano, believed to have belonged to the fleeing kidnappers.”

“Following subsequent investigation, three individuals, namely Samaila Adamu, Illiyasu A. Abdu, and Mamman Abdullahi, were arrested and identified by the kidnapped victim as being involved in his abduction. An investigation is currently ongoing at the State Criminal Investigation Department.”
